On a daily basis, we experience noise in our environment, such as the noises from tv and radio, home devices, and web traffic. Generally, these sounds are at secure levels that do not damage our hearing. Audios can be damaging when they are as well loud, also for a quick time, or when they are both loud and resilient.
NIHL can be prompt or it can take a long time to be visible. It can be momentary or permanent, and it can affect one ear or both ears. Also if you can't inform that you are harming your hearing, you might have trouble hearing in the future, such as not being able to comprehend various other individuals when they chat, particularly on the phone or in a loud room.
Direct exposure to harmful noise can occur at any type of age. People of any ages, including youngsters, teens, young adults, and older people, can create NIHL. Based upon a 2011-2012 CDC research involving hearing examinations and meetings with individuals, at least 10 million adults (6 percent) in the united state under age 70and perhaps as lots of as 40 million grownups (24 percent)have functions of their hearing test that suggest hearing loss in one or both ears from direct exposure to loud sound.
Appears at or listed below 70 A-weighted decibels (dBA), even after lengthy exposure, are not likely to trigger hearing loss. Lengthy or repeated exposure to sounds at or over 85 dBA can cause hearing loss.
A good rule of thumb is to avoid sounds that are as well loud, also close, or last too long. Hearing depends on a collection of occasions that change acoustic waves in the air right into electric signals
Resource: NIH/NIDCD Audio waves go into the external ear and travel through a narrow passageway called the ear canal, which brings about the eardrum. The eardrum vibrates from the inbound sound waves and sends out these resonances to 3 small bones in the center ear. These bones are called the malleus, incus, and stapes.
As the hair cells relocate up and down, tiny hair-like projections (called stereocilia) that perch in addition to the hair cells bump against an overlying framework and bend. Flexing causes pore-like networks, which are at the tips of the stereocilia, to open up. When that occurs, chemicals rush right into the cell, developing an electric signal.

At high energies, acoustic injury can lead to disturbance of the tympanic membrane and ossicular injury. Much acoustic trauma is brought on by impulse sound, which is generally because of blast result and the quick expansion of gases. Acoustic injury is commonly the consequence of a surge. Impact sound arises from the collision of steels.
Effect sound is more most likely to be seen in the context of work-related sound exposure. It is frequency laid over on a background of more continual sound. Boettcher has actually revealed that when influence noise is superimposed on continuous sound, the harmful capacity is synergistically enhanced. Animals with big PTS from an initial noise direct exposure showed less PTS complying with second noise direct exposure at a specific strength compared to pets with little or no previous NIHL, indicating that these pets are much less conscious succeeding sound exposures.
This suggests that the major factor liable for these outcomes is lower efficient strength of the second sound for the ears with huge first PTS. Various other physiologic problems that influence the likelihood and development of NIHL have been recognized. Evidence appears in the literature that decreased body temperature level, raised oxygen stress, reduced free radical development, and removal of the thyroid gland can all decrease a person's sensitivity to NIHL.
Excellent experimental proof reveals that sustained exposure to moderately high levels of sound can lower an individual's sensitivity to NIHL at higher levels of noise. This process is described as audio conditioning. It goes to the very least superficially similar to the protective impact an intentional training routine has for extreme exercise.
